Questions worth asking

Why not just send from my own domain?

Because cold email damages sender reputation, and that damage is permanent enough to matter. Once your primary domain is filtered, your invoices, contracts and client mail are filtered with it. Pipefire keeps the sending on domains that are designed to be replaced.

Is cold email legal?

In the UK, EU and US, B2B cold email is legal when you identify yourself, provide a working opt-out and honour it. Every message we send carries a List-Unsubscribe header and a visible opt-out, and suppression is enforced before send rather than after.

What happens when a domain burns?

It is pulled from rotation automatically and a replacement is provisioned, configured and warmed without you doing anything. On Pro and Scale this is automatic; on Standard we do it manually for you.

Do I own the domains?

Yes. They are registered for you and you have full DNS control. If you leave, they leave with you.

How long until I can send?

Fourteen days on Standard and Pro — that is the warmup, and skipping it is why most cold email fails. On Scale your infrastructure comes from a pool that has already been warming, so the first send goes out the day you sign.
